There are no accessible parking spaces, however, some will be designated at the school on the day, in the cordoned off area in Brighton Road.
There is a dropping off point in front of the school.
All voters will access the building through the main entrance and exit via the Brighton Road entrance which has steps.
Anyone with a disability or mobility issues can exit through the main entrance again.
The school main Hall will be used for voting, it is on the ground floor and is level.
Step free-access:
Not applicable – polling station is on the ground floor.
There is no hearing loop system available.
Assistance dogs are permitted inside the polling station.
If you need to use a screen reader or other assistive technology you’ve brought with you, please speak to a Parish Official (Autorisé or Adjoint).
You can bring someone with you to the polling station, but if you need help filling in your ballot paper, a Parish Official (Autorisé or Adjoint) will help you.
If you need to use a coloured overlay, a small LED lamp for extra lighting or a magnifier for your ballot paper, please speak to a Parish Official (Autorisé or Adjoint) and they will help you.
